Yes, you 'can' view (as I note above) the cache in almost any (maybe all) browsers...but what you can easily DO once you get there is sometimes pretty limited. Before I found these programs, I used a couple of really user-friendly file managers to access the cache and its files, and moved and deleted and copied what I wanted. Even then, it was often tricky.

And....a little known and certainly not publicized item is that, IF you have browsers other than Internet Explorer, their caches and temp files are indexed and/or saved by Windows in I.E.s temp folders! That is, even if you tell Opera or Firefox to clear downloaded files each day, the records of what and when you accessed various internet sites may still be kept in IE/Windows temp folder!
It takes some work to change this behavior....I'll post some details if anyone really wants..(I 'think' I already did a few months ago...I'll look)
